This book was really good and sad at the same time. I really felt the pain of the salmon family and I loved how I could follow their grieving. 

It was very realistic in the sense of not getting any closure. I also really enjoyed the fact that we are viewing it from Susie’s perspective and how she yearns to be with her family and make it right. 

It was a really good book and very sad. I really do feel sorry for what the characters went through but I’m glad they have managed to move on.
